Zoetis (NYSE:ZTS – Get Free Report)‘s stock had its “market perform” rating reiterated by investment analysts at William Blair in a research report issued on Thursday,Benzinga reports.
Several other research analysts have also recently issued reports on the stock. Stifel Nicolaus dropped their target price on shares of Zoetis from $95.00 to $85.00 and set a “hold” rating on the stock in a report on Friday, June 26th. Wall Street Zen lowered shares of Zoetis from a “buy” rating to a “hold” rating in a report on Saturday, May 2nd. Weiss Ratings cut shares of Zoetis from a “sell (d+)” rating to a “sell (d)” rating in a research report on Friday, June 12th. HSBC cut their price objective on shares of Zoetis from $140.00 to $95.00 and set a “buy” rating on the stock in a report on Monday, July 6th. Finally, Citigroup lowered their target price on Zoetis from $145.00 to $112.00 and set a “buy” rating for the company in a report on Monday, May 18th. Seven investment anal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ating, nine have assigned a Hold rating and one has issued a Sell rating to the stock. According to data from MarketBeat.com, the stock has an average rating of “Hold” and an average target price of $118.33.
Zoetis Stock Up 3.1%
Zoetis (NYSE:ZTS –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, August 6th. The company reported $1.87 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.85 by $0.02. Zoetis had a return on equity of 66.85% and a net margin of 27.80%.The firm’s quarterly revenue was down .2%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business posted $1.76 EPS. Zoetis has set its FY 2026 guidance at 6.150-6.250 EPS. As a group, research analysts forecast that Zoetis will post 6.87 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Zoetis News Summary
Here are the key news stories impacting Zoetis this week:
- Positive Sentiment: Zoetis reported second-quarter adjusted earnings of $1.87 per share, above the $1.84–$1.85 consensus range and up from $1.76 a year earlier. The earnings beat is likely the primary catalyst supporting the stock. Zoetis Q2 Earnings Beat
- Positive Sentiment: The company maintained strong profitability, reporting a 27.8% net margin and 66.85% return on equity. Its earnings growth despite largely flat revenue may reassure investors about cost management and operating efficiency. Zoetis Earnings Report
- Neutral Sentiment: Zoetis appointed Jay Saccaro as chief financial officer and chief operating officer. The expanded leadership role could improve financial and operational coordination, but investors may wait for more details on his priorities and expected impact. Zoetis Appoints Jay Saccaro
- Negative Sentiment: Management cut fiscal 2026 adjusted EPS guidance to $6.15–$6.25, well below the roughly $6.87 analyst consensus, and reduced revenue guidance to $9.1–$9.3 billion versus approximately $9.8 billion expected. Zoetis Cuts Fiscal 2026 Outlook
- Negative Sentiment: Quarterly revenue declined 0.2% year over year, while softer U.S. pet-healthcare demand, fewer veterinary visits and more price-sensitive customers remain concerns for companion-animal products. Pet Healthcare Demand Slows
About Zoetis
Zoetis Inc (NYSE: ZTS) is a global animal health company that develops, manufactures and markets a broad portfolio of products and services for companion animals and livestock. The company’s offerings include pharmaceuticals, vaccines and biologics, parasiticides and anti-infectives, as well as diagnostic instruments, consumables and laboratory testing services. Zoetis serves the veterinary community, livestock producers and other animal-health customers with products designed to prevent, detect and treat disease and to support animal productivity and welfare.
Zoetis traces its roots to the animal health business of Pfizer and became an independent, publicly traded company following a 2013 separation and initial public offering.
